Symptoms of a Frozen System
Blocked from freedom is not just a physical condition—it’s a symptom of deeper rot. This jailer’s experience mirrors real challenges facing correctional facilities worldwide:
- Overcrowding and Inhumane Conditions: Cells jammed beyond capacity force staff into environments where maintaining order becomes nearly impossible, eroding both security and humanity.
- Lack of Accountability: When those in authority face no oversight, misconduct festers. Guards may witness or suffer abuse but remain silenced by fear or complicity.
- Emotional Toll and Betrayal: Trust erodes when the system fails victims and guards alike. One jailed by bureaucracy and extremism finds solidarity with inmates—not as allies, but as fellow prisoners of circumstance.
- A Cycle of Despair: For guards caught inside not by law, but by injustice, escape feels not just futile, but impossible—leaving trauma deeply embedded.

Beyond the Bars: A Call for Systemic Reform
Escape may be impossible, but change must begin where the truth often hides: behind closed doors. Addressing the crisis requires:
- Transparency and Oversight: Independent audits and whistleblower protections empower those inside to speak safely and truthfully.
- Accountability and Training: Heavy accountability paired with trauma-informed training helps guards resist corruption and treat detainees with dignity.
- Rehabilitative Justice: Shifting from punitive institutions to systems focused on rehabilitation reduces both crime and the cycles that trap individuals—and staff—forever.
- Support for the Caretakers: Mental health resources and peer support prevent guards from internalizing institutional violence, preserving their sense of purpose.
